Jump to content
Search In
  • More options...
Find results that contain...
Find results in...

spectre

Users
  • Posts

    6,041
  • Joined

  • Last visited

Everything posted by spectre

  1. можете переименовать в xml_ например если не нужен - удалить
  2. ну вы же видите ошибку - значит не отключен удалите его модификатор и обновите кеш модификаторов или он свое событие добавил
  3. отключите унисендер или почините, написано же
  4. это все индивидуально от шаблона зависит, нет серебряной пули обратитесь в услуги или ко мне в личку, за скромное вознаграждение решу
  5. Потому что admin/language/ru-ru/catalog/product.php
  6. Посмотрите как сделан вывод подкатегорий в catalog/controller/product/category.php и сделайте аналогично, оно именно так и работает
  7. catalog/controller/checkout/success.php в сессии есть order_id по order_id получить заказ и взять оттуда его сумму
  8. Так напишите в поддержку модуля https://www.opencart.com/index.php?route=marketplace/extension/info&extension_id=23152
  9. если google base или сайтмап формируется нормально то нет можно обратить внимание на опцию правильного настраиваемого фида которые в модуле они as is и не поддерживаются, это не основная задача модуля
  10. вам идти к тому кто добавлял length2 или в раздел https://opencartforum.com/forum/18-настройка-и-мелкая-работа-по-уже-существующему-сайту/
  11. На форуме каждый день появляется куча тем что "подключили SSL и все сломалось, циклический редирект и тп" В подавляющем большинстве случаев нужен редирект с www на без и на https с без Первым делом отключаем редиректы в панели хостинга, до добра они никогда не доводят и делаем сами Инструкция для Apache т.к. почти на всех хостингах используется он Все правила редиректов нужно вставлять в файл .htaccess который лежит в корне магазина в этот блок после RewriteBase / ! www редирект простой RewriteCond %{HTTP_HOST} ^www\.(.*)$ [NC] RewriteRule ^(.*)$ https://%1/$1 [R=301,L] с HTTPS все интереснее, т.к. разные хостинги используютт разные сборки вебсерверов и методы определения HTTPS они разные Вторая часть правила у нас будет неизменная RewriteRule ^(.*)$ https://%{SERVER_NAME}%{REQUEST_URI} [R=301,L] А вот первую придется выбрать из RewriteCond %{HTTP:SSL} !=1 RewriteCond %{HTTPS} =off RewriteCond %{SERVER_PORT} !^443$ RewriteCond %{ENV:HTTPS} !on RewriteCond %{HTTP:X-Forwarded-Proto} !https RewriteCond %{HTTP:X-HTTPS} !1 Этого хватит для почти всех хостингов Расскажу как понять какой тип определения HTTPS вам нужен открываем файл index.php и пишем туда echo '<pre>'; print_r($_SERVER); echo '</pre>'; открываем сайт по http и видим что-то подобное ищем знакомые слова из блока с редиректами и видим [HTTP_X_FORWARDED_PROTO] => http Значит у нас получится конструкция такого рода #Правила для редиректа RewriteCond %{HTTP:X-Forwarded-Proto} !https RewriteRule ^(.*)$ https://%{SERVER_NAME}%{REQUEST_URI} [R=301,L] #Правила для с www на без RewriteCond %{HTTP_HOST} ^www\.(.*)$ [NC] RewriteRule ^(.*)$ https://%1/$1 [R=301,L] если хотите чтобы robots.txt был доступен роботам по http то первым правилом этого блока нужно добавить RewriteCond %{REQUEST_FILENAME} !^robots.txt$ [NC] Если вам лень читать это все и вы просто промотали сюда - подберите просто методом тыка, это занимает 5 минут Спасибо за внимание, ваш spectre
  12. Видимо нет text_seo_pro в en-gb и тп ну и подровняли бы
  13. никак привяжитесь к чему-то более уникальному
  14. это сразу же дописал как вспомнил))) вообще идея создать памятку для всех, тк ее как оказалось за столько лет нет
  15. в оригинальном htaccess это есть, это на совести "авторов"
  16. Согласен, подразумевается что человек если не понимает правил то и не сможет их применить и обратится к специалисту) Я с вашего позволения добавлю это новым правилом
  17. в конфиге админки тоже надо заменить через блокнот (шутка, не используйте блокнот)
  18. ну может где-то вывод раньше идёт в php вариантов много. пробуйте удалить-прменять одно значение массива а там найдёте откуда ноги
×
×
  • Create New...

Important Information

On our site, cookies are used and personal data is processed to improve the user interface. To find out what and what personal data we are processing, please go to the link. If you click "I agree," it means that you understand and accept all the conditions specified in this Privacy Notice.